Display the Routing Table

Displaying the modem router's internal routing table can assist you or NETGEAR technical
support in diagnosing routing problems.
To display the routing table:
1.
Launch an Internet browser from a computer or WiFi device that is connected to the
network.
2.
Type http://www.routerlogin.net.
A login screen displays.
3.
Enter the user name and password for the modem router.
The user name is admin. The default password is password. The user name and
password are case-sensitive.
4.
Click the OK button.
The BASIC Home screen displays.
5.
Select ADVANCED > Administration > Diagnostics.
The Diagnostics screen displays.
6.
Click the Display button.
The Diagnostics - Routing Table screen displays the routing table.
To return to the Diagnostics screen, click the Back button.
